How to Protect Yourself Online When Websites Lack Transparency

When encountering websites like Fareporto.com that lack transparency, clear legal frameworks, and contact information, it’s essential to adopt a proactive and cautious approach.

Relying on such sites can expose you to risks ranging from data breaches and malware infections to financial scams.

Instead of blindly trusting every link or service, understanding how to verify legitimacy and employing robust protective measures can significantly enhance your online security.

Prioritize Websites with Clear Privacy Policies and Terms of Service

Before interacting significantly with any website, always look for easily accessible Privacy Policies and Terms of Service. These documents are non-negotiable for legitimate platforms.

  • Privacy Policy: Explains how your personal data is collected, used, stored, and protected. If a site doesn’t have one, or if it’s vague, consider it a major red flag.
  • Terms of Service or Use: Outlines the legal agreement between you and the website, including acceptable use, intellectual property, and dispute resolution. Without these, you have no clear understanding of your rights or the site’s responsibilities.
    Actionable Tip: If you can’t find these documents, or they’re hidden, it’s best to avoid providing any personal information or clicking on external links from that site.

Utilize Secure Browsing Practices and Tools

Your web browser and its extensions are your first line of defense.

  • Use a Reputable Browser: Browsers like Brave Browser, Mozilla Firefox, or Google Chrome with privacy-enhancing extensions offer built-in security features and regular updates to protect against vulnerabilities.
  • Employ Ad and Tracker Blockers: Extensions like uBlock Origin or Privacy Badger block intrusive ads and prevent third-party trackers from collecting your browsing data. This not only enhances privacy but also speeds up page loading times.
  • Verify SSL Certificates HTTPS: Always ensure the website uses HTTPS indicated by a padlock icon in your browser’s address bar. While not a guarantee of legitimacy, it ensures that your connection to the site is encrypted, protecting data exchanged from eavesdropping.

Be Wary of Unsolicited Links and Downloads

Exercise extreme caution with links from unknown sources, especially those found on sites with poor transparency.

  • Hover Before You Click: Before clicking a link, hover your mouse over it without clicking to see the actual URL in your browser’s status bar. If the URL looks suspicious or doesn’t match the expected destination, do not click it.
  • Avoid Unknown Downloads: Never download software, executables, or files from untrusted websites. These can contain malware, ransomware, or viruses. Stick to official app stores or reputable vendor websites.
  • Use a VPN: A Virtual Private Network ProtonVPN or ExpressVPN encrypts your internet connection and masks your IP address, adding an extra layer of privacy and security, especially when browsing on public Wi-Fi.

Conduct Due Diligence and Background Checks

If a website seems questionable, take a few moments to do some quick research.

  • Search for Reviews: Use search engines like DuckDuckGo or Startpage to search for reviews, complaints, or discussions about the website. Look for terms like “Fareporto.com review,” “Fareporto complaints,” or “Fareporto scam.” Websites like Trustpilot, Reddit, and BBB Better Business Bureau can be valuable resources for user experiences.
  • Check Domain Information: Use a WHOIS lookup tool to find registration details for the domain. While some information might be privatized, unusually recent registration dates, or registrations in obscure locations, can be warning signs.
  • Assess Content Quality: Legitimate websites typically feature professional-grade content, correct grammar, and up-to-date information. Poorly written content, numerous typos, or outdated information can indicate a low-quality or potentially fraudulent site.

How do I check if a website is using HTTPS?

You can check if a website is using HTTPS by looking for a padlock icon in the browser’s address bar and ensuring the URL starts with “https://” rather than just “http://”.

What is a WHOIS lookup and how can it help?

A WHOIS lookup tool allows you to search for registration details of a domain name, such as its creation date, registrar, and sometimes registrant contact information, which can help assess a site’s legitimacy.
